The sheath fuzzy operations on fuzzy numbers of type L-R are much easier than general fuzzy numbers.It would be interesting to approximate a fuzzy number by a fuzzy number of type L-R.In this paper, we state and prove two significant application inequalities in the monotonic functions set.These inequalities show that under a condition, the nearest fuzzy number of type L-R to an arbitrary fuzzy number exists and is unique.After that, the nearest fuzzy number of type L-R can be obtained by solving a linear system.

Note that the trapezoidal fuzzy numbers are a particular case of the fuzzy numbers of type L-R.The proposed method can represent the nearest trapezoidal fuzzy number to a given fuzzy number.Finally, to approximate fuzzy solutions of a fuzzy linear system, we apply our idea to construct a framework to find solutions of Fridge Light Cover crisp linear systems instead of the fuzzy linear system.The crisp linear systems give the nearest fuzzy numbers of type L-R to fuzzy solutions of a fuzzy linear system.The proposed method is illustrated with some examples.
